El Kaakour or Qaaqour (Arabic: القعقور) is a small village in the Matn District of Lebanon.[1] It's about 930 meters above sea level. It's located in a very mountainous area surrounded by pine trees. All people born in Kaakour are Maronite of the following families: Mazloum, Ashkar, Jerdak, Abou Antoun
Population: around 2000.
The families Abou Antoun and Mazloum migrated from Tartij to Kaakour in 1820.
